NVIDIA Titan Xp has a maximum frequency of 1.427 GHz. Memory size 12 GB. Memory type GDDR5X. Released in Q2/2017.

ASUS Phoenix Radeon RX 550 2G EVO has a maximum frequency of 1.100 GHz. Memory size 2 GB. Memory type GDDR5. Released in Q2/2020.
